Understanding Browser Games

Browser games are typically played directly in a web browser, eliminating the need for downloads or installations. This accessibility makes them appealing, especially for casual gamers. Here are some key features of browser games:

  • Accessibility: Play anytime, anywhere, with just an internet connection.
  • Lower Costs: Many browser games are free-to-play, making them financially accessible.
  • Minimal Hardware Requirements: They can run on almost any device, from laptops to smartphones.

Exploring PC Games

On the other hand, PC games often require dedicated hardware and software. They can range from demanding AAA titles to indie gems that require specific operating systems. Here are some advantages of PC gaming:

  • Superior Graphics and Performance: High-end PCs can deliver stunning visuals and smoother gameplay.
  • Extensive Game Library: Access to a vast array of titles across various genres.
  • Community Interaction: Many PC games offer modding, allowing players to enhance their gaming experience.

Who Plays Browser Games?

It’s crucial to understand the demographic attracted to browser games. Many of these players include:

  • Casual Gamers: Those looking for quick entertainment without commitment.
  • Students: Quick breaks between classes.
  • Anyone with Limited Time: Perfect for users who can only spend a few minutes at a time.

The Allure of PC Games

PC games attract a different crowd, often more dedicated and willing to invest time and money. Common players include:

  • Hardcore Gamers: Seeking sophisticated gameplay and immersion.
  • Esports Enthusiasts: Those who compete in gaming tournaments.
  • Modding Fans: Gamers who love to customize their play style through mods.
